Business Manager (Technology) - Investment Bank
1 month ago
City of London
Business Manager (Technology) - Investment Bank. Financial Services, Banking, Investment Banking. The Business Manager will help support the COO, Head of Digital Engineering Services and Department Heads with governance, reporting, business management, administration, resource management, vendor man